Elasticsearch 中的矢量搜索:设计背后的基本原理

作者:Adrien Grand 你是否有兴趣了解 Elasticsearch 用于矢量搜索(vector search)的特性以及设计是什么样子? 一如既往,设计决策有利有弊。 本博客旨在详细介绍我们如何选择在 Elasticsearch 中构建矢量搜索。 矢量搜索通过 Apache Lucene 集成到 Elasticsearch 中 首先是有关 Lucene 的一些背景知识:Lucene 将数据组织成...

Infragistics Ignite UI Crack

Infragistics Ignite UI Crack Improved layout heuristics when creating CSS Flexbox layouts from Figma designs that use auto-layout. Added 'Stepper' and 'Reveal Dashboard' to the component toolbox. Yo...

Lecture 9 Lexical Semantics

目录 Introduction: sentiment analysis 引言:情感分析Word Semantics 单词语义Word meanings 单词含义WordNetSynsets 同义词集Noun Relations in WordNetHypernymy Chain 上位链Word SimilarityWord Similarity with PathsBeyond Path LengthA...

Elasticsearch 集群架构监测 调试 优化

Elasticsearch 集群架构监测 调试 优化 一、简介1. 定义2. 集群架构 二、 集群架构监测1. 概念和意义2. 集群架构的基本指标3. 使用 Elastic Stack 进行集群监测 三、 集群架构调试1.概念和意义2. 常见故障及其排查方法2.1 节点异常2.2 数据分片失效 3. 使用 Elasticsearch 内置API 进行调试 四、集群架构优化1.概念和意义2.优化方案及实现...

Elasticsearch:数据是如何被写入的?

在我之前的文章 “Elasticsearch:索引数据是如何完成的”,我详述了如何索引 Elasticsearch 的数据的。在今天的文章中,我将从另外一个视角来诠释如何写入数据到 Elasticsearch。更多关于 Elasticsearch 数据操作,请阅读文章 “Elasticsearch:彻底理解 Elasticsearch 数据操作”。 发送写请求时,它会通过我们路由机制。 此过程有助于确定哪...

编译robotics_transformer

Hub - google-research/tensor2robot: Distributed machine learning infrastructure for large-scale robotics research 2.编译proto文件为python文件 robot@robot:~/ref$ mkdir protoc_3.3 robot@robot:~/ref$ cd protoc_3.3/...

【ElasticSearch 进阶】倒排索引 + FOR + RBM压缩算法

1. 倒排索引 如果有100w的数据,进行分词后,每个id按数字类型进行存储,假设每个行数据都包含相同的词,则每个词的 Posting List 需要占用约4M的空间: 极大的浪费了空间。则需要对Posting List 进行压缩,压缩算法有:FOR + RBM 2. FOR压缩算法 FOR算法的核心思想是用减法来削减数值大小,从而达到降低空间存储。 假设V(n)表示数组中第n个字段的值,那么经过FOR...

elasticsearch

条的文档的id,然后根据id获取文档。是根据词条找文档的过程。 倒排索引虽然要先查询倒排索引,再查询正向索引,但是无论是词条、还是文档id都建立了索引,查询速度非常快!无需全表扫描。 2.  ElasticSearch 和mysql 的对应关系  3.索引库dsl操作 3.1mapping映射属性 mapping是对索引库中文档的约束,常见的mapping属性包括: type:字段数据类型,常见的简单类型...

Google Analytics 电子商务跟踪

的电子商务网站上,当用户在浏览器中点击“购买”按钮时,用户的购买信息就会发送给执行交易的网络服务器。如果成功,服务器会将用户重定向至提供交易详情和购买收据的“谢谢”页面或收据页面。您可以使用analytics.js库将“谢谢”页面中的电子商务数据发送到Google Analytics(分析)。 可以使用analytics.js发送两种类型的电子商务数据:交易数据和商品数据。交易数据交易是指发生在您网站...

(四)elasticsearch 源码之索引流程分析

中主要类的关系如下:   2. 索引流程我们用postman发送请求,创建一个文档 我们发送的是http请求,es也有一套http请求处理逻辑,和spring的mvc类似// org.elasticsearch.rest.RestController private void dispatchRequest(RestRequest request, RestChannel channel, Res...
© 2024 LMLPHP 关于我们 联系我们 友情链接 耗时0.007382(s)
2024-05-06 18:23:46 1714991026